2022年环氧玻璃市场价值为127亿美元,预计2023年至2032年年复合成长率为6.9%,到2032年将达到246亿美元。

环氧玻璃是环氧树脂与玻璃纤维布结合的复合材料。也称为 FR4 或玻璃纤维增强环氧树脂。这种组合产生了一种复合材料,将玻璃纤维的强度与环氧树脂的黏合和刚度结合在一起。环氧玻璃应用于电子、航空、汽车、建筑等各领域。

环氧玻璃因其优异的机械性能、耐化学性、耐腐蚀性、耐用性和优异的电绝缘性能而被广泛应用于各个行业,导致市场成长。环氧玻璃因其优异的机械性能和对外部影响的抵抗力而被用于海洋领域。由于其强度高、重量轻、耐腐蚀,广泛应用于船舶建造。编织玻璃具有高拉伸强度并涂有环氧树脂,是船体、甲板和其他结构元件的理想选择。这提高了船的整体结构完整性,同时减轻了重量,使其更容易移动并使用更少的燃料。

环氧玻璃在海洋工业中的主要优点之一是其耐水、耐盐和耐海洋环境中常见的各种化学物质。这项功能有助于阻止劣化,延长海洋工程的使用寿命。环氧玻璃可提供有效的电流绝缘,使其适用于涉及布线、电气控制板和电子设备的海洋应用。此外,环氧玻璃也用于建造船舶零件,包括天线罩、天线盖和通讯天线。由于环氧玻璃是一种介电材料,因此可以以最小的干扰传输讯号,使其成为维持海上可靠通讯和导航系统的理想选择。此外,使用环氧玻璃可以更轻鬆地维护和修理容器。环氧玻璃的黏合特性可以使受损零件顺利黏合,从而保持容器的结构完整性。此外,环氧玻璃的多功能性有助于对复杂的航海设计进行修改和适应。

环氧玻璃用于建造石油、天然气探勘等近海领域的海底机械和管道。由于环氧玻璃具有耐腐蚀、耐压力和极端水下环境的特性,因此是维持这些关键零件的耐用性和使用寿命的最合适方法。由于这些因素,环氧玻璃已成为海洋领域的重要零件,并推动市场成长。

可再生能源的激增也推动了环氧玻璃市场的成长。环氧玻璃是建造风力发电机叶片的理想材料,风力涡轮机叶片是利用风力发电发电的基本零件。环氧玻璃因其高机械强度重量比而用于风力发电。风力发电机叶片必须重量轻且耐用,以承受风速和湍流变化引起的动态负载和应力,并有效地收集风力发电。环氧基玻璃复合材料将纤维的坚固性与环氧树脂的轻质性相结合,透过生产能够承受恶劣条件的叶片,同时有效地将风力发电转化为电能,创造了这种平衡。

风力发电机叶片暴露在各种天气因素下,例如雨水、紫外线和温度变化。环氧玻璃耐候、耐腐蚀、耐紫外线,可延长叶片寿命并降低维护和替换成本。环氧玻璃的耐用性对于位于偏远或海上位置的风电场尤其重要,因为这些地方的维护困难且昂贵。

环氧玻璃优异的电绝缘性能使其可用于风力发电。风力发电机叶片通常包含感测器、加热元件和用于性能监控和管理的控制系统。环氧玻璃可减少漏电和干扰,确保这些组件安全可靠地运作。由于这些因素,对可再生能源特别是风力发电的需求不断增长,刺激了环氧玻璃市场的成长。

环氧玻璃的高製造成本限制了市场的成长。环氧玻璃是将特殊材料环氧树脂与玻璃纤维布混合製成的。玻璃纤维必须按照精确的规格编织,而环氧树脂则是需要精确配方和加工的聚合物。这些材料价格昂贵,因此製造成本很高。

环氧玻璃的製造方法有很多种,包括用环氧树脂涂覆编织玻璃,在受控条件下固化,以及添加成型和精加工技术。这些任务需要专门的设备、知识和受控环境,这增加了工作成本。此外,还需要严格的品管程序,以确保环氧玻璃产品始终保持高品质。成品的机械品质和性能可能会受到其他参数变化的影响,例如树脂与纤维的比例、固化条件和其他因素。严格的品管需要更多的测试、检查和返工,从而提高了製造成本。

环氧玻璃的生产在使用的额外材料和能源方面都可能造成浪费。製造过程更加昂贵,因为它需要适当的处置并遵守环境法规。由环氧玻璃製成的产品可能很脆弱,在储存和运输过程中必须小心处理,以防止损坏。物流成本受这些因素的影响。由于这些原因,高製造成本限制了环氧玻璃市场的成长。

製造流程的进步为环氧玻璃市场创造了绝佳的成长机会。这些进步使得製造流程能够得到更精确的控制,新技术得到了开发,环氧玻璃的应用范围也扩大了。传统技术需要手动安装玻璃布并用环氧树脂浸渍,这需要大量的时间和精力。机器人系统利用先进的自动化技术精确定位和浸渍织物。这减少了人为错误的可能性,提高了树脂分布和织物排列的一致性,从而形成更坚固、更一致的复合材料结构。

积层製造技术用于製造环氧玻璃和其他复合材料。使用 3D 列印逐层创建复杂的客製化结构,与传统的减材工艺相比,提供了设计弹性并减少了浪费。此外,透过在环氧树脂中添加奈米颗粒、奈米纤维等奈米材料可以改善材料性能。奈米材料提高了环氧玻璃复合材料的机械强度、导热性和电气性能,使其在各种应用中更加有用。由于这些因素,环氧玻璃生产的技术进步为市场创造了利润丰厚的成长机会。

According to a new report published by Allied Market Research, titled, "Epoxy Glass Market," The epoxy glass market was valued at $12.7 billion in 2022, and is estimated to reach $24.6 billion by 2032, growing at a CAGR of 6.9% from 2023 to 2032.

Epoxy glass is a composite material produced by combining epoxy resin with woven glass fabric. It is also known as FR4 or fiberglass-reinforced epoxy. This combination produces a composite material by combining the strengths of glass fibers with the adhesive and stiff properties of epoxy resin after being injected within the glass fabric and afterwards curing in regulated conditions. Epoxy glass is used in various sectors, including electronics, aviation, automotive, construction, and others.

Epoxy glass is employed more often across a range of industries due to their great mechanical properties, resistance to chemicals and corrosion, durability, and exceptional electrical insulation characteristics leading to the growth of the market. Epoxy glass is utilized in the marine sector owing to its superior mechanical qualities and resilience to external influences. It is widely used in boat and ship construction due to its great combination of strength, light weight, and corrosion resistance. As it has a high tensile strength and is coated with epoxy resin, the woven glass fabric is a great option for hulls, decks, and other structural elements. This improves the overall structural integrity of boats while keeping their weight in control, which helps them move more easily and use less fuel.

One of epoxy glass's key advantages in the marine industry is its resistance to water, salt, and various chemicals usually found in marine conditions. This feature, which helps to stop deterioration, extends the lifespan of marine projects. Since it provides effective insulation against electrical currents, epoxy glass is suitable for applications on ships involving wiring, control panels, and electronic equipment. In addition, epoxy glass is used to construct marine parts including radomes, antenna covers, and communication dishes. It is the ideal choice for preserving dependable communication and navigation systems at sea owing to its dielectric features, that enable signals to be sent with minimal interference. Moreover, the use of epoxy glass improves maintenance and repair of marine vessels easily. Its adhesive properties allow for the smooth bonding of broken pieces, preserving the vessel's structural integrity. Also, the versatility of epoxy glass helps for modification and adaptability to intricate nautical designs.

Epoxy glass is used to build subsea machinery and pipelines in offshore sectors like oil and gas exploration. It is the most suitable means of maintaining the durability and lifespan of these crucial components as to its resistance to corrosion, pressure, and extreme underwater environments. Owing to these factors, epoxy glass is an integral part in the marine sector that drives the growth of the market.

The surge in renewable energy also drives the growth of epoxy glass market. Epoxy glass is the ideal material for constructing wind turbine blades, which are fundamental components in harnessing wind energy for electricity generation. It is used in wind energy owing to its high mechanical strength-to-weight ratio. Wind turbines' blades must be light and durable to withstand the dynamic loads and stresses brought on by shifting wind speeds and turbulence to effectively collect wind energy. Epoxy glass composites, which combine the robustness of glass fibers with the light weight of epoxy resin, create this balance by producing blades that can survive challenging conditions while effectively converting wind energy into electricity.

Wind turbine blades are exposed to various meteorological elements, such as rain, UV rays, and temperature changes. The blades' extended life provides lower maintenance and replacement costs due to epoxy glass' natural resistance to weathering, corrosion, and UV deterioration. For wind farms situated in distant or offshore regions, where maintenance might be difficult and expensive to do, the durability of epoxy glass is especially important.

The excellent electrical insulating properties of epoxy glass enable its use in wind energy. Wind turbine blades usually include sensors, heating elements, and control systems for performance monitoring and management. Epoxy glass reduces electrical leakage and interference, ensuring the safe and dependable operation of these components. Owing to these factors, the rise in demand for renewable energy, particularly wind energy, stimulated the growth of the epoxy glass market.

The high manufacturing cost of epoxy glass restrains the market growth. Epoxy glass is produced by mixing the specialized materials epoxy resin and woven glass fabric. Glass fabric must be woven to precise specifications, while epoxy resin is a polymer that requires precision formulation and processing. The cost of production increases as these materials are costly.

Epoxy glass is created in many ways, such as by coating glass fabric with epoxy resin, curing it under controlled conditions, and even adding shaping and finishing techniques. These operations require specialized equipment, knowledge, and controlled environments, which increases operational costs. Furthermore, rigid quality control procedures are needed to ensure epoxy glass products are of consistently high quality. The mechanical qualities and performance of the finished product can be impacted by changes to other parameters, such as the resin-to-fiber ratio, curing conditions, or other factors. By requiring more testing, inspection, and rework, strict quality control drives up manufacturing costs.

Epoxy glass production may result in waste, both in terms of additional materials used and energy used. The production process is more expensive as proper disposal and adherence to environmental rules are required. Products made of epoxy glass might be delicate, so damage prevention measures must be taken when handling them during storage and shipping. Costs associated with logistics are influenced by these factors. Owing to these reasons, high production cost limits the growth of the epoxy glass market.

The advancements in the manufacturing process created an excellent growth opportunity for the epoxy glass market. These advancements have led to more precise control over the manufacturing process and the development of new techniques, expanding the range of applications for epoxy glass. Traditional techniques involve manually setting up glass fabric and impregnating it with epoxy resin, which demands an immense amount of time and effort. Robotic systems precisely place and saturate the fabric with resin due to advancements in automation technology. By doing this, the possibility of human mistake is decreased, and consistency in resin distribution and fabric alignment is improved, leading to composite constructions that are stronger and more consistent.

The production of epoxy glass and other composite materials uses additive manufacturing techniques. Since complicated and customized structures are created layer by layer using 3D printing, it offers flexibility in design and reduces waste compared to traditional subtractive procedures. Furthermore, the improvement of material characteristics has been made possible by the addition of nanomaterials, such as nanoparticles and nanofibers, into epoxy resin. Epoxy glass composites have their mechanical strength, thermal conductivity, and electrical characteristics enhanced by nanomaterials, making them even more useful in a variety of settings. Owing to these factors, the technological advancements in the manufacturing of epoxy glass presented a lucrative growth opportunity for the market.
